It's the 14 and 14a up into the Little Big Horns that's the fun part! Some of the longest, steepest HWY in the country! There's a big sign up at Burgess junction that basically tells you if you're here in a truck, you're screwed. :)

+1 on Adamk's recommendation of Highway 14A. Lots of twisties and great scenery. I rode it from Cody heading to Denver back in May and it was one of the highlights of the ride.
